﻿@charset "utf-8";
/*reset*/
/* CSS reset for c_b */
body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, form, fieldset, input, textarea, p, blockquote, th, td { margin: 0; padding: 0; }
table { border-collapse: collapse; border-spacing: 0; }
table th, table td { padding: 5px; }
fieldset, img { border: 0; }
address, caption, cite, code, dfn, em, th, var { font-style: normal; font-weight: normal; }
ol, ul { list-style: none; }
ception, th { text-align: left; }
q:before, q:after { content: ''; }
abbr, acronym { border: 0; }
a { color: #000; text-decoration: none; }
/*for ie f6n.net*/
a:focus { outline: none; }
/*for ff f6n.net*/
a:hover { text-decoration: underline; }
/*定位*/
.tl { text-align: left; }
.tc { text-align: center; }
.tr { text-align: right; }
.bc { margin-left: auto; margin-right: auto; }
.fl { float: left; display: inline; }
.fr { float: right; display: inline; }
.zoom { zoom: 1 }
.hidden { visibility: hidden; }
.vam { vertical-align: middle; }
.clear { clear: both; height: 0; line-height: 0; font-size: 0; }
p { word-spacing: -1.5px; }
-moz-box-sizing: content-box; -webkit-box-sizing: content-box; box-sizing: content-box;
/*其他*/
.curp { cursor: pointer }
;
/*原reset*/
sup { vertical-align: baseline; }
sub { vertical-align: baseline; }
input, button, textarea, select, optgroup, option { font-family: inherit; font-size: inherit; font-style: inherit; font-weight: inherit; }
input, button, textarea, select { *font-size: 100%; }
input, select { vertical-align: middle; }
body { font: 12px/1.231 arial, helvetica, clean, sans-serif; }
select, input, button, textarea, button { font: 99% arial, helvetica, clean, sans-serif; }
table { font-size: inherit; font: 100%; border-collapse: collapse; }
pre, code, kbd, samp, tt { font-family: monospace; *font-size: 108%; line-height: 100%; }
/*title*/
h1 { font-size: 32px; }
h2 { font-size: 26px; }
h3 { font-size: 20px; }
h4 { font-size: 14px; }
h5 { font-size: 12px; }
h6 { font-size: 10px; }
/*end reset*/
/* CSS Document */
body { background-color: #fff; overflow-x: hidden; color: #000; font-size: 14px; font-family: microsoft yahei, "宋体"; position: relative; width: 100%;min-width: 1100px}
/*网站字体颜色*/
.header, .content, .footer, .container { margin-left: auto; margin-right: auto; width: 1100px; }
/*页眉*/
.header { width: 100%; overflow: hidden; background: url(../images/header_top.png) no-repeat center top; }
.headerTop { overflow: hidden; height: 145px; }
.headerTop h1 { float: left; margin-top: 45px; }
.headerTop .wen { float: left; margin-left: 10px; margin-top: 55px; padding-left: 10px; border-left: 1px dotted #ccc; }
.headerTop h2 { font-size: 24px; color: #0476dc; }
.headerTop .wen p { font-size: 18px; color: #ff0000; font-weight: bold;}
.headerTop .headr {float: right;margin-right: 64px;overflow: hidden;}
.headerTop .htop {overflow: hidden;margin-top: 10px;/* margin-bottom: 35px; */}
.headerTop .htop li { float: left; font-size: 13px; padding: 0 10px; border-right: 1px dotted #6b6b6b; }
.headerTop .htop a { color: #6b6b6b; }
.headerTop .htop .last { padding-right: 0; border: none }
.headerTop .phone { padding-left: 50px; text-align: right; background: url(../images/phone.png) no-repeat left bottom; }
.headerTop .phone p { font-size: 14px; color: #343434; text-align: left;}
.headerTop .phone h3 { font-weight: normal; font-family: Arial; font-size: 30px; color: #2589e9; }
.headerNav { overflow: hidden; width: 100%; height: 58px; background-color: #0262b8; }
.headerNav li {float: left;line-height: 58px;font-size: 16px;background: url(../images/nav_bor.png) right top repeat-y;}
.headerNav li a {color: #fff;text-decoration: none;display: block;padding: 0 36px;}
.headerNav li.last { background: none }
.headerNav li.cur, .headerNav li:hover { background: url(../images/nav_cur.png) repeat-x center; }
.search1{ overflow:hidden; width:100%; height:50px; }
.search1 .scenter{ overflow:hidden; height:50px; background: url(../images/plc.png)no-repeat left center;}
.search1 .scenter span{line-height: 50px;font-size: 14px;padding-left: 30px;}
/*左侧*/ 
.nlist{ float:left; width:230px;}
.nlist .tit{color:#fff; font-size:26px; background:url(../images/tit1n.gif) no-repeat; height:63px; line-height:63px;  padding: 0 0 0 38px;overflow:hidden; }
.nlist .nr{ overflow:hidden; margin-bottom:10px;}
.nlist .nr h4{background: url("../images/sidebar_icon4.png") no-repeat scroll 9px center #0054aa;height:51px;line-height:51px;padding-left:28px;overflow:hidden;font-size:18px;font-weight:normal;}
.nlist .nr h4:hover {background: url("../images/sidebar_icon1.png") no-repeat scroll 9px center #ff9900;}
.nlist .nr h4 a{color:#fff;}
.nlist .nr ul{padding:10px 18px 20px; height:auto; background:#fff; }
.nlist .nr li{color: #666;line-height: 35px; overflow: hidden;white-space: nowrap; height:35px;border-bottom:1px dashed #a7a7a7}
.nlist .nr li.cur,.leib2 .nr li:hover{background: url(../images/icon1h.gif) no-repeat scroll 33px center;}
.nlist .nr li a{ font-size:14px; display:block; padding-left:31px;}
.nlist .nr li.cur a,.leib2 .nr li a:hover{ color:#fa7821;}
.nlist .nr .li-last{ border:0;}
.t05 {line-height:50px;background:#0262b8;margin-top:10px;padding:0 10px; color:#fff;font-size:18px;}
.t05 a{color:#fff;}
.t05_cons1 {  border-top:0; padding:5px 10px 10px; margin-bottom:10px; zoom:1;background:#fff;} 
.t05_cons1 li {white-space:nowrap; overflow:hidden; text-overflow:ellipsis;background: url(../images/dian.png) left center no-repeat; line-height: 35px;height:35px; overflow: hidden; background-size: 10px;  padding-left: 12px; width: 195px;*padding-left:15px; font-size:14px;border-bottom: 1px dashed #a7a7a7}
/*footer*/
.footer {overflow: hidden;width: 100%;height: 400px;background-color: #3e3e3e;}
.footer .f_nav { overflow: hidden; height: 60px; background: #0262b8; margin-bottom: 24px; }
.footer .f_nav li { float: left; font-size: 14px; line-height: 60px; background: url(../images/f_nav_bor.png) right center no-repeat; padding: 0 27px; }
.footer .f_nav li a { color: #fff; }
.footer .f_nav .last { background: none }
.footer .link { overflow: hidden; margin-bottom: 15px; }
.footer .link h3 { float: left;margin-left: 10px; font-size: 16px;color: #fff;}
.footer .link ul { overflow: hidden; float: left; margin-left: 30px; }
.footer .link li { float: left; margin: 0 10px; font-size: 13px; }
.footer .link li a { color: #a2a2a2; }
.footer .f_btm { overflow: hidden; margin-bottom: 35px; }
.footer dl { overflow: hidden; float: left; width: 800px; }
.footer dt { overflow: hidden; float: left; margin-top: 50px; }
.footer dd { overflow: hidden; float: left; margin-left: 35px; padding-left: 50px; border-left: 1px solid #545353; height: 140px; padding-top: 20px; width: 500px; }
.footer dd p { font-size: 14px; color: #fff; line-height: 28px; }
.footer dd em { margin: 0 10px; }
.footer .phone { overflow: hidden; background: url(../images/phone.png) left center no-repeat; padding-left: 45px; margin-top: 20px; }
.footer .phone span { display: block; font-size: 12px; color: #fff; }
.footer .phone h4 { font-weight: normal; font-size: 24px; color: #fff; }
.footer .ewm { overflow: hidden; float: right; margin-top: 20px; text-align: right; }
.footer .ewm img { display: block; float: right }
.footer .ewm .ewen { float: left; float: right; margin-right: 20px; }
.footer .ewm P { font-size: 16px; color: #b5b5b5; }
.footer .ewm b { display: block; font-size: 19px; color: #b0b0b0; font-family: Arial; margin: 8px 0; }
.footer .ewm span { display: block; font-size: 16px; color: #fff; font-weight: bold; }
#roll_top, #fall, #ct { position: relative; cursor: pointer; height: 52px; width: 52px; }
#roll_top { background: url(../images/top.jpg) no-repeat; }
#fall { background: url(../images/top.jpg) no-repeat 0 -80px; }
#ct { background: url(../images/top.jpg) no-repeat 0 -40px; }
#roll { display: block; width: 15px; margin-right: -515px; position: fixed; right: 50%; top: 50%; _margin-right: -575px; _position: absolute; _margin-top: 300px; _top: expression(eval(document.documentElement.scrollTop)); }

.con_tit{margin-top: 20px;font-size: 22px;line-height: 30px}
.con_list{margin-top: 20px;width: 100%;height: auto}
.con_list li{background: ;height: auto;margin: 10px 0;padding: 20px 0 20px 90px;list-style: none;line-height: 60px;}
.con_list li p{font-size: 16px;}
li.con_adr{background: #f1f1f1  url(../images/adr.png) no-repeat 10px center; }
li.con_tel{background: #f1f1f1  url(../images/tel.png) no-repeat 10px center; }
li.con_eml{background: #f1f1f1  url(../images/eml.png) no-repeat 10px center; }
.jialan_conct{position:fixed;z-index:9999999;top:100px;right:-127px;cursor:pointer;transition:all .3s ease;}
.jialan_bar ul li{width:310px;height:53px;font:16px/53px 'Microsoft YaHei';color:#fff;text-indent:54px;margin-bottom:3px;border-radius:3px;transition:all .5s ease;overflow:hidden;}
.jialan_bar .jialan_top{background:#f28709 url(../images/fixcont.png) no-repeat 0 0;}
.jialan_bar .jialan_phone{background:#f28709 url(../images/fixcont.png) no-repeat 0 -57px;}
.jialan_bar .jialan_QQ{text-indent:0;background:#f28709 url(../images/fixcont.png) no-repeat 0 -113px;}
.jialan_bar .jialan_ww{text-indent:0;background:#f28709 url(../images/fixcont.png) no-repeat 0 -169px;}
.jialan_bar .jialan_ercode{background:#f28709 url(../images/fixcont.png) no-repeat 0 -225px;}
.hd_qr{padding-left:15px;}
.jialan_top a, .jialan_QQ a, .jialan_ww a{display:block;text-indent:54px;width:100%;height:100%;color:#fff;}
#pngFixs { width: 300px; height: 33px; background: #EEE; border: none }
#word tr, #word td { height: 40px; line-height: 40px }
#word input { width: 200px; height: 30px; line-height: 30px; font-size: 12px; color: #666; text-indent: 5px; border-radius: 3px; border: 1px solid #CCCCCC; background: #FFF; }
#content1 { margin-top: 7px; height: 100px; width: 400px; float: left; background: #FFF; border: 1px solid #CCCCCC; border-radius: 3px; }
.message_yzmico, #valid { float: left; margin-top: 12px }
/*询价车*/
.xunjia{height: 44px;overflow: hidden;font-size: 16px;margin-top:10px;}
.xunjial{background-color: #ff7300;margin-right: 10px;float: left;width: 150px;height: 40px;line-height: 40px;color: #fff;text-align: center;cursor:pointer;}
.xunjiar{float: left;width: 150px;height: 40px;line-height: 40px;border:1px solid #f2dcbc;background: url(../images/iconxun.png) no-repeat 14px center;background-color: #fff5ec;color: #ff712b;text-indent: 38px;cursor:pointer;}
.xunjial:hover{ background-color: #ff500b;}
.xunjiar:hover{border-color: #f9d59e;background-color: #ffecda;color: #f46200;}
#carBuying{width:240px;position:fixed;bottom:0px;left:0px;background:#FFF;z-index:999;border:1px solid #DDD}
    .car_title{width:100%;height:40px;line-height:40px;background:#0262b8;color:#FFF;text-align: center}
    .car_title span{width:20px;height:20px;line-height:18px;font-size:20px;text-align: center;display: block;float:right;margin-top:10px;background: rgba(0,0,0,0.3);margin-right:8px;cursor: pointer}
    .car_title span:hover{background:rgba(0,0,0,0.6);}
    .car_title a{color:#FFF;border:1px solid #AAA;float:left;margin:10px;height:20px;line-height:20px;width:36px;font-size:12px;}
    .car_title a:hover{background:#666;}
    #car_shop{width:240px;height:260px;overflow:auto}
    #car_shop div{width:96%;padding:2%;height:50px;color:#555;font-size:12px;line-height:20px;
        position: relative;border-bottom:1px dashed #DDD}
    #car_shop div img{width:50px;height:50px;float:left;margin-right:5px;}
    .shop_del{position:absolute;bottom:0px;right:5px;color:#FF0000;cursor: pointer}
    .shop_xunjia{position:absolute;bottom:0px;right:40px;color:#FF0000;cursor: pointer;}
    #car_shop div:hover{background:#F9F9F9}



/*foo-bootom*/




.ewmBox { background: url(../images/xfbg.png) repeat; bottom: 0; height: 60px; left: 0; position: fixed; width: 100%; z-index: 100; }
.ewmBoxIn { height: 60px; line-height: 60px; margin: 0 auto; position: relative; width: 1200px; }
.ewmBoxIn p { font-size: 28px; font-weight: bold; color: #fff; }
.ewmBoxIn p b { font-size: 48px; color: #f00; }
.ewm2 { bottom: 0px; height: 60px; position: absolute; right: 0; width: 60px; z-index: 999; }
.ewm2 img.wxxt { height: 60px; width: 60px; }
.ewm2 img.wxxt1 { bottom: 60px; display: none; left: -120px; position: absolute; }
.ewm2:hover .wxxt1 { display: block; }


